摘 要:目的 观察丹参酮对病毒性心肌炎小鼠心肌是否具有保护作用,并探讨其作用机制.方法 清洁级近交系Balb/c小鼠,雄性,4~6周龄,共110只.采用随机数字表法将小鼠分为5组,分别为心肌炎对照组、JAK激酶2(janus kinase 2,JAK2)抑制剂组(JAK2抑制剂组)、丹参酮ⅡA组(丹参酮组)、JAK2抑制剂加用丹参酮组(JAK2抑制剂+丹参酮组)各25只,以及正常对照组10只.苏木精伊红(HE)染色后光镜下观察小鼠心肌组织病理学改变.免疫组织化学法、蛋白质印迹分析法检测心肌信号转导子与转录激活子1(STAT1)磷酸化表达水平.化学发光法测定小鼠血清心肌肌钙蛋白-Ⅰ(cTnI)的表达水平.将心肌病理积分与磷酸化STAT1(p-STAT1)的免疫组织化学吸光度值、血清cTnI含量作相关性分析.结果 (1)心肌病理炎症积分检测结果:JAK2抑制剂组和JAK2抑制剂+丹参酮组小鼠心肌病理炎症积分均明显高于心肌炎对照组(3.35±0.57和3.34±0.54比2.12±0.39,P均<0.01),丹参酮组小鼠心肌病理炎症积分明显低于心肌炎对照组(1.40 ±0.34比2.12±0.39,P<0.01).(2)心肌细胞p-STAT1表达水平的检测结果:JAK2抑制剂组和JAK2抑制剂+丹参酮组小鼠心肌p-STAT1表达水平的平吸光度值均明显低于心肌炎对照组(0.017±0.010和0.020±0.010比0.246±0.010,P均<0.01),与正常对照组比较差异则无统计学意义(P>0.05),而丹参酮组心肌p-STAT1表达水平则明显高于心肌炎对照组(0.444±0.060比0.246±0.010,P<0.01).(3)血清cTnI水平检测结果:心肌炎对照组、JAK2抑制剂组、丹参酮组及JAK2抑制剂+丹参酮组小鼠血清cTnI水平均明显高于正常对照组[(0.42±0.06)、(1.17±0.25)、(0.23-±0.05)和(1.04±0.19) μg/L比(0.02±0.01) μg/L,P均<0.01].JAK2抑制剂组和JAK2抑制剂+丹参酮组小鼠血清cTnI水平均明显高于心肌炎对照组[(1.17±0.25)和(1.04�Objective To explore the effects of tanshinone and JAK2/STAT1 signaling pathway related mechanism in CVB3-induced myocarditis in murine.Methods A total of 110 inbred male Balb/c mice which were 4 to 6 weeks-old were randomly divided into five groups:normal control (N,n =10),myocarditis control (C,n =25),tanshinone group (T,15 mg ·kg-1· d-1,i.p.,n =25),janus kinase 2 inhibitor AG490 group (A,10 mg· kg-1 · d-1,i.p.,n =25),T + A group (H,n =25).Myocarditis was induced by 0.5 ml 10-9.51 TCID50/ml CVB3 i.p.injection for 10 days in group C,T and H.Myocardial histopathologic changes were observed and phospho-STAT1 expressions were detected by immunohistochemistry and Western blot analysis.The levels of serum cardiac troponin Ⅰ were detected with chemiluminescence immunoassay.Results (1) Compared with group C,the histopathologic scores were significantly higher in group A and H (3.35 ±0.57 and 3.34 ±0.54 vs.2.12 ±0.39,P 〈0.01),but lower in group T (1.40 ± 0.34 vs.2.12 ± 0.39,P 〈 0.01).(2) The expression of p-STAT1 protein was similar in group A and H compared to group N (P 〉 0.05),but was significantly lower than that in group C (0.017 ± 0.010 and 0.020 ± 0.010 vs.0.246 ± 0.010,P 〈 0.01).The expression of p-STAT1 protein was significantly higher in group T than in group C (P 〈 0.01).(3) The levels of serum cardiac troponin Ⅰ in group C,A,T and H were significantly higher than in group N ((0.42 ±0.06),(1.17 ±0.25),(0.23 ± 0.05) and (1.04 ±0.19) μg/L vs.(0.02 ±0.01) μg/L,all P 〈0.01).The levels of serum cardiac troponin Ⅰ were significantly higher in group A and H compared with group C ((1.17 ±0.25) and (1.04 ± 0.19)μg/L vs.(0.42 ±0.06)μg/L,P 〈 0.01),but were significantly lower in group T than in group C ((0.23 ±0.05) μg/L vs.(0.42 ±0.06) μg/L,P 〈0.01).(4) There was a negative correlation between the expression level of p-STAT1 and the histopathologic scores(y
